If you are a console gamer as opposed to a PC one, then no, you do not. Here are the pros and cons of getting a 4K TV for gaming. There are a lot of issues with gaming in 4K as it stands today, and for a lot of people, it's definitely not a good reason to get a 4K TV. Playing a game using four times as many pixels isn't the clear-cut win it may seem at first glance. "There's no 4K movie or TV shows yet, but think of the games!" With the absence of pretty much anything else to watch in 4K today, gaming is one of the most commonly mentioned uses for 4K TVs. Today there are plenty of TVs for sale with 4K resolution, the successor to high-definition TV, but almost no actual 4K content.
